/* CSS Document */
body {
	margin-top: 11px;
	margin-bottom: 20px;
	background-image: url(images/tlo.gif);
	background-repeat: repeat-x;
	background-position: top;
	background-color: #CACACA;
	overflow-x: hidden;
	line-height: 15px;
	font-size: 11px;
}
.main {
	margin-top: 11px;
	background-color: #FFFFFF;
	border: 10px solid #FFFFFF;
}
#naglowek {
	margin-left: auto;
	margin-right: auto;
	width: 720px;
	height: 53px;
	padding-top:6px;
}
#menu_baner {
	margin-left: auto;
	margin-right: auto;
	width: 720px;
	border-bottom-width: 10px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
}
.border_boki {
	border-right-width: 10px;
	border-left-width: 10px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#ffffff;
	border-left-color: #ffffff;
	background-color: #FFFFFF;
}
td {
	color: #333333;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-heght: 15px;
}
a {
	text-decoration:none;
	color: #d50000;
}
a#rozdzielczosc {
	color: #FFFFFF;
}
div#belka_pobierz {
	background-color: #B6B6B6;
	text-align: center;
	width: 134px;
	height: 15px;
	margin-top: 1px;
	vertical-align: middle;
	line-height: 15px;
}
div#belka_modele_testowe {
	background-color: #B6B6B6;
	text-align: center;
	width: 150px;
	height: 15px;
	margin-top: 1px;
	vertical-align: middle;
	line-height: 15px;
}
div#box_marine, div#box_moto, div#box_promocje, div#box {
	font-family : Verdana, Arial, Helvetica;
	font-size : 11px;
	font-weight: bold;
	padding-left: 10px;
	height: 20px;
	line-height: 20px;
}
div#box {
	background-color: #000000;
	color: #ffffff;
}
div#box_promocje {
	background-color: #FF9900;
	color: #000000;
}
div#telko {
	background-color: #fbfbfb;
}
#telko ul {
	list-style: none;
	margin: 0;
	padding: 0;
}
#telko li {
	padding: 2px 0;
	margin-left: 15px;
}
#news_moto {
	color: #d50000;
	font-weight:bold;
}
#news_marine {
	color: #2260AD;
	font-weight:bold;
}
#dealer {
	border: 1px solid #000000;
}
#newsy {
	padding-left: 12px;
	padding-right: 12px;	
}
/* cenniki */
th#marine, th#moto {
	font-family: Verdana;
	font-size: 13px;
	font-weight: bold;
	height: 35px;
	text-align:center;
}
th#marine, div#box_marine {
	background-color: #2260AD;
	color: #FFFFFF;
	text-transform: uppercase;
}
th#moto, div#box_moto {
	background-color: #d50000;
	color: #FFFFFF;
	text-transform: uppercase;
}
#news_moto {
	line-height: 15px;
	color: #d50000;
	font-weight:bold;
}
td {
	color: #333333;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}
h1 {
	font-family: Verdana;
	font-size: 14px;
}
h2 {
	font-size: 12px;
}
p {
	font-size: 11px;
	text-align: justify;
	line-height: 15px;
}
li {
	line-height: 15px;	
}
select, input, textarea {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.wybrany {
	font-weight:bold;
	background-color: #B6B6B6;
	color:#FFFFFF;
}
/* baner lewa */
.box_obwodka {
	border: 1px solid #D4D0C8;
	padding: 1px;
	width: 188px;
}
.baner_foto {
	width: 188px;
	height: 77px;
}
.baner_podpis {
	background-color: #696969;
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: 16px;
	width: 184px;
	text-align: left;
	padding-left: 4px;
}
/* baner lewa */
#iframe {
	position: relative;
	width: 800px;
	margin-left: -410px;
	left: 50%;
}

.foto {
	border: 1px solid #000000;
	padding: 1px;
}

.men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: 20px;
	padding-left: 15px;
}

.kolumna_prawa {
	padding-left: 10px;
}

.blad {
	border: 1px solid #FF0000;
}
.blad_napis {
	color:#F00;	
}
pre {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 14px;
 	overflow-x: auto; /* Use horizontal scroller if needed; for Firefox 2, not needed in Firefox 3 */
 	white-space: pre-wrap; /* css-3 */
 	white-space: -moz-pre-wrap !important; /* Mozilla, since 1999 */
 	white-space: -pre-wrap; /* Opera 4-6 */
 	white-space: -o-pre-wrap; /* Opera 7 */
	width: 710px; 
 	word-wrap: break-word; /* Internet Explorer 5.5+ */
}
.serwfin_baner {
	padding: 2px;
	border: 2px solid #CACACA;	
	
}